LOUIS VUITTON AND MILANO DESIGN WEEK: APPOINTMENT AT GARAGE TRAVERSI WITH OBJETS NOMADES

Louis Vuitton Objets Nomades is the collection composed of ingenious, creative furniture and functional objects that, since 2012, has expanded to accommodate the creations of an ever-increasing number of celebrated international design names. The creative starting point is the “Art of Travel,” the Maison’s heritage for more than 160 years and a reinterpretation of its essential spirit, each Objet Nomade is an expression of a unique combination of designers’ creativity and Louis Vuitton’s unparalleled savoir-faire.

The new objects will be the protagonists of the fifth edition of the exhibition celebrating ten years of the “Louis Vuitton Objets Nomades” collection in Milan, on the occasion of Design Week 2022, in the Garage Traversi space, an admirable example of rationalist architecture and a historical place for the Milanese tradition, designed by Architect Giuseppe de Min, which after twenty years of inactivity, is returned to the city of Milan completely renovated.

All the new features
New additions include the Merengue pouf by the Campana brothers in three colors along with Aguacade, an ultra-colorful, modular screen; the Petal Chair by Marcel Wanders Studio with its organic tree-like structure; the Cosmic Table by Raw Edges with its innovative carbon fiber base and ice-like glass top; and the Totem Lumineux by Louis Vuitton Studio, an elegant tower of colored spheres in Murano glass; the new Belt Stool and Belt Lounge Chair precious leather seats by Atelier Oï; the Signature Armchair & Sofa, with graceful, flowing arches inspired by terraced fields in China and desert rock formations in the U.S. Designed by Frank Chou, the latest designer to join the Louis Vuitton Objets Nomades project, they are also the first specially designed for outdoor furniture and are upholstered in a brightly colored “Brio” fabric by Italian brand Paola Lenti.

In celebration of Louis Vuitton’s Art de Vivre, Atelier Oï’s delightful leather Origami flowers will also be displayed in Louis Vuitton’s signature flower kiosk in the heart of Milan, and a few steps away the newsstand will display the City Guide, Travel Book and Fashion Eye series published by the Maison.
